从 html 输入字段中,我将日期输入为date/month/year
. 假设用户输入的日期是
28/06/2013
。我想将此日期存储在我的mysql
dbms 中。
我该怎么做呢 ?我想存储日期以供以后检索。
例如,如果日期是,2008/4/5
那么我们可以使用以下代码对其进行格式化...
String source="2008/4/5";
SimpleDateFormat format = new SimpleDateFormat("dd/MM/yyyy");
java.sql.Date d= new java.sql.Date(format.parse(source).getTime());
您不应直接在 SQL 中使用任何用户输入。相反,您应该进行参数化查询,并定义一个java.sql.Date
参数。然后,使用SimpleDateFormat
Java 类将用户输入转换为 Date 对象,并用它填充参数。